Immunotherapy for anyβ has actually been a investigate hotspot, Whilst terrific development has become manufactured, it is much from meeting the requirements of clinical software. Early immunotherapy was simply just concentrating on Aβ without having distinguishing involving unique structural varieties, resulting in minimized levels of Aβ inside the brain but no enhancement in cognitive dysfunction in AD mice and clients, or critical Unwanted effects. Targets of recent immunotherapeutic analysis have turned to particular poisonous Aβ structural forms, including Aβ monomers, oligomers, and fibers. The antibody focusing on Aβ monomer at present under investigation is mainly Solanezumab, a humanized, IgG1 monoclonal antibody that targets the Aβ13–28 amino acid residue sequence. Research in Advert mice have shown that solanezumab principally acknowledges soluble Aβ monomers and binds to yourβ plaques when used in huge doses (Bouter et al., 2015). In the period II medical research of Advertisement individuals, solanezumab improved the total Aβ40 and also aβforty two stages within the plasma and CSF of people, but didn't Increase the score on the ADAS-Cog14 cognitive scale in section III trials (Doody et al.
